1975 AMC Hornet – V8 Automatic
A well-preserved example of an increasingly uncommon American compact, this 1975 AMC Hornet combines originality, single-family ownership history, and tasteful updates.
Retained in single-family ownership from new until 1998, the car remains largely original with only minimal restoration work performed over the years. It presents as an honest and well-kept example that has been carefully maintained.
Powered by a 210 HP 304 cu. in. V-8 engine paired with a three-speed automatic transmission, this Hornet delivers dependable performance with classic 1970s American character.
Finished in attractive red paint with white Hornet side stripes and a black interior, the car has a clean and period-correct appearance. Notable upgrades include air conditioning improvements and LED lighting for improved usability while driving.
A solid, well-cared-for survivor with desirable V8 power and long-term ownership history, this 1975 AMC Hornet is an interesting and practical classic with growing enthusiast appeal.
